Google Android developer verification process: What Developers Need to Know

📝 Executive Summary (In a Nutshell)

  • Google is officially rolling out Android developer verification to all developers to combat bad actors distributing harmful apps.
  • The verification mandate begins enforcement in September 2024 for Brazil, Indonesia, Singapore, and Thailand, with a global expansion planned for next year.
  • This initiative aims to enhance user safety, build greater trust in the Android ecosystem, and reduce developer anonymity that facilitates malicious activities.

2.1. The Problem of Anonymity

One of the primary drivers behind the new verification mandate is the issue of anonymity. Currently, it is relatively easy for individuals or groups with malicious intent to create developer accounts using minimal or false information. This lack of verifiable identity makes it challenging for Google to hold these entities accountable when they breach policies or distribute harmful software. By requiring developers to verify their identity, Google aims to raise the barrier for entry for bad actors, making it significantly harder for them to hide, re-emerge, and continue their harmful activities. This proactive step helps to ensure that everyone operating within the Android ecosystem does so transparently and responsibly.

2.2. Types of Harmful Apps Addressed

The verification process targets a broad spectrum of harmful applications. These include, but are not limited to:

  • Malware and Spyware: Apps designed to steal personal information, track user activity, or damage devices.
  • Phishing Scams: Applications that mimic legitimate services to trick users into divulging credentials or sensitive data.
  • Ad Fraud: Apps that generate fake ad impressions or clicks, defrauding advertisers and consuming user data/battery.
  • Deceptive Apps: Applications that promise functionality they don't deliver, often leading to subscriptions or unwanted downloads.
  • Spam and Bot Networks: Apps used to generate fake reviews, ratings, or spread misinformation.

By making developers identifiable, Google can more effectively trace and ban repeat offenders, significantly reducing the prevalence of these detrimental applications on the Play Store.

4. Phased Rollout and Enforcement Timeline

Google has outlined a strategic, phased approach to the implementation and enforcement of the new developer verification mandate, acknowledging the global scale of the Android ecosystem and the varying regulatory landscapes.

4.1. Initial Enforcement Regions: September 2024

The first wave of mandatory enforcement will commence in September 2024, targeting specific high-growth and strategically important markets. These regions include:

  • Brazil
  • Indonesia
  • Singapore
  • Thailand

These countries represent a significant portion of Android users and developer activity, making them ideal proving grounds for the verification system. The experience gained from these initial markets will undoubtedly inform the subsequent global expansion, allowing Google to refine its processes and address any unforeseen challenges effectively.

4.2. Global Expansion Next Year

Following the successful rollout and enforcement in the initial regions, the verification mandate is slated to expand globally next year. This broader rollout will encompass all other countries where Android apps are published, making developer verification a universal requirement for accessing the Google Play Store. Developers in regions not part of the initial September enforcement should therefore prepare for these requirements to become mandatory within the next year. This phased approach allows Google to scale its operations and support systems appropriately, ensuring a smoother transition for the entire developer community. 7. Google's Broader Play Store Security Strategy

The Android developer verification program is not an isolated measure but rather an integral component of Google's overarching strategy to enhance the security and integrity of the Play Store. It complements a suite of existing and continuously evolving security protocols.

7.1. Complementary Security Measures

Google already employs a multi-layered security approach, which includes:

  • Google Play Protect: A built-in malware protection service that scans apps on your device and before you download them.
  • Policy Enforcement: Strict developer policies that govern app content, behavior, and data handling, enforced by a dedicated review team and AI systems.
  • Vulnerability Reward Programs: Incentivizing security researchers to find and report vulnerabilities in Google's platforms and apps.
  • API Restrictions and Permissions: Granular control over app permissions and access to sensitive device data, with continuous updates to limit potential abuse.
  • Automated Scanning and Machine Learning: Advanced systems that constantly scan for suspicious patterns, code, and developer behavior.

The verification process adds a foundational layer by authenticating the source of the applications, making all subsequent security measures more effective by focusing on legitimate entities.

8. Preparing for the Google Android Developer Verification Process

For Android developers, preparation is key to ensuring a smooth transition and continued presence on the Google Play Store. Proactive steps can minimize disruption and ensure compliance before deadlines hit.

8.1. Actionable Steps for Developers

  • Monitor Google Play Console Communications: Google will use the Play Console and associated email addresses for official announcements regarding the verification process, deadlines, and specific requirements.
  • Gather Required Documentation: Begin compiling necessary identity documents (passport, driver's license, national ID) for individuals, or business registration documents, tax IDs, and authorized representative information for organizations. Ensure all documents are current and match your Play Console account information.
  • Ensure Account Information is Up-to-Date: Verify that all contact information (email, phone number), payment details, and registered addresses in your Play Console account are accurate and current. Discrepancies could delay the verification process.
  • Understand Regional Nuances: If operating in Brazil, Indonesia, Singapore, or Thailand, be especially vigilant about the September 2024 enforcement. For developers in other regions, use this time to prepare for the global rollout next year.
  • Be Prepared for Potential Follow-Ups: Google's verification team may request additional information or clarification. Having documents readily accessible and responding promptly will expedite the process.
